Women's Cross Country Takes 4th at Skyline Championship

Race Results

NEWBURGH, N.Y.
—In team's Skyline debut, Sarah Lawrence College women's cross country placed fourth at the 2014 Skyline Women's Cross Country Championship, hosted by Mount Saint Mary College at Hudson Valley Sportsdome on Sunday.

For the sixth time this season, SLC was led by Natalie Grieco (Glen Ellyn, Ill./Fenwick), who captured Skyline All-Conference Second Team accolades with her 11th-place finish on the day. The sophomore won in a head-to-head sprint and crossed the line in 22:16 on the 5K course.

Rookie Katherine Shepard (Visalia, Calif./Mount Whitney) reached the finish as the Gryphons No. 2 runner, taking 19th place overall. With her time of 23:00, she took 17 seconds off her previous time on the course and completed her third-straight race as one of SLC's top two runners.

Just two spots back, senior Elizabeth Emery (Mexico, N.Y./Mexico) finished her final championship race in 23:09, a mere eight seconds off her season best.

Rookie Tiffany Meier (Goleta, Calif./Olive Grove Charter) posted a career best 24:40—32 seconds faster than her previous record—to capture 38th place on the day. Classmate Georgia Cohen (New York, N.Y./UNC School of the Arts) rounded out the Gryphons' scoring runners in 50th place with a mark of 26:11. Cohen's run clinched a fourth-place team score of 130 points, well ahead of fifth-place Yeshiva.

First year Nawshin Abanti (Dhaka, India/International School Dhaka) also broke her personal record by more than 30 seconds. She stopped the clock in 26:22 for 54th place. Sophomore Melissa Molina (Union, N.J./Union) posted a season best of 27:44, good for 60th place overall.

Rookie Marisa Acosta (San Diego, Calif./Canyon Crest Academy) took 54 seconds off her previous time on the course, finishing with a season-best 27:52. Fellow first year Danielle Dyen-Shapiro (Estero, Fla./Cypress Lake) was the final Gryphon to finish, taking more than two minutes off her personal best in 32:19.

St. Joseph's College Long Island won the event for the fifth straight season and for the eighth time in nine seasons. SJC captured the top two spots and four of the top five. Seven Golden Eagles placed among the top 12.

Sarah Lawrence's fourth-place finish far surpasses the team's predicted eighth-place finish in the league's coaches' poll. Purchase College experienced the most significant decline, falling from fourth place in the poll to ninth at the championship.

Sarah Lawrence cross country concludes the season at the NJIT Nick Russo Halloween Classic on Sunday, Nov. 2.
